    scott-uk-slimissimo-fully-automatic-bean-to-cup-coffee-machine-19-bar-pressure-1-1l-1470w-1813.jpgA bean to coffee machine is a machine commercial which automatically grinds beans and dispensing milk-based drinks like cappuccino and latte. They also texturize milk to create creamy drinks. They don't require any instruction for personnel to use them.

    They come with pre-sets that can save and adjust the coffee settings to ensure that your employees and customers can enjoy a good cup of coffee each time.

    Cost

    Bean to coffee machines can be more expensive than pod-based models. This is due to the fact that it requires to grind and prepare the beans before brewing, as well as being more sophisticated with features such as milk-frothing capabilities. However, it can save money over the long term by eliminating the need to purchase regular quantities of coffee pods.

    With a bean-to-cup machine you'll also save money on coffee-related equipment, as many models come with built-in grinders and milk-steamers. There are also models that are smaller, which makes them more suitable for those with small space. Additionally, a bean-to-cup machine can be more environmentally friendly since it reduces coffee waste and avoids the necessity for pre-packaged pods.

    Bean-to-cup machines have the capacity to produce various drinks, such as espressos, cappuccinos and flat whites. They can be set up to produce drinks that have been programmed and do not require training for staff. This is ideal for restaurants and bars, as baristas are free to concentrate on other tasks.

    A bean-to-cup machine will also grind the correct amount of beans machines per cup. This ensures that each cup of coffee has a consistent taste and aroma. It can also eliminate problems that may arise from preground or pod-based coffee, such as incorrect pressure tamping or uneven extraction.

    Although the initial purchase of a bean to cup coffee machine might be more expensive than a pod-based machine, it can save money over the long term. Beans are generally less expensive than pods of coffee, and a bean-to-cup machine will eliminate the ongoing cost of compatible capsules.

    Additionally, the majority of models of bean-to-cup coffee machines are designed to be simple to maintain and clean. They are typically more efficient in cleaning and descaling than pod-based models and are able to detect automatically when they require cleaning or descale. Some include reminders to complete these tasks. It is crucial to follow the directions provided by the manufacturer, because non-compatible cleaning or descaling solutions can invalidate your warranty.

    Maintenance

    Bean-to-cup machines create beverages using fresh milk and beans unlike pod machines. They also make drinks with a delicious flavour. They may cost more to operate because they require a larger initial investment. They also require regular cleaning and maintenance to ensure that they function properly. If you don't regularly clean your machine it could lead to taste problems and lead to bacteria accumulation in the pipes and tubes.

    To prevent this from happening it is essential to clean the coffee maker on a regular basis. The best method for doing this is by using a commercial descaler, such as Arfize. White vinegar is not suitable for this purpose, as the acetic acid can damage the seals and components of the machine. In addition, it is essential to perform a backflush every 2 weeks. This is essential as it eliminates any milk residues that could be accumulating in the pipes and tubes.

    Every week, you should clean the brewing group as well as milk nozzles. This will ensure that the machine is free of limescale, as as other deposits. It can also help to prevent future blockages. It is also an ideal idea to run a full descaling cycle once a month. This will prevent blockages, ensure the highest level of hygiene and also meet the health and safety standards.

    Bean-to-cup coffee machines can be difficult to maintain, but it is possible to make your machine last longer by following these tips. Choose a brand that provides detailed instructions on how you can maintain the machine. This will allow you understand how the machine functions and the steps you must follow to maintain it. This will ensure that you get the best out of your machine and avoid costly mistakes.
